The Science Behind Regularity
The benefits of consistency in fitness are rooted in both physiology and psychology. Regular exercise triggers the release of endorphins, the body’s natural mood enhancers, which not only lift your spirits but also create a sense of accomplishment and mental clarity. This biochemical cascade is amplified when exercise becomes habitual, paving the way for what can be described as a continuous performance boost.
Physiologically, a consistent workout plan optimizes muscle memory and metabolic function. The body adapts to regular physical stress by enhancing its efficiency, reducing recovery time, and ultimately increasing strength and endurance. In this way, consistency is not just a matter of routine—it is a powerful mechanism for transformation that yields quantifiable results over time.
Crafting Your Consistency Workout Plan
Designing a consistency workout plan begins with setting clear, realistic goals. Define what peak performance looks like for you. Is it a specific weightlifting milestone, a new personal best in running, or improved flexibility and balance? Once you establish these benchmarks, create a structured plan that fits your lifestyle and commitments.
Break your routine into manageable segments. Incorporate a mix of cardiovascular exercises, strength training, and flexibility work. For example, you might start with a brisk walk or jog to get your heart rate up, move on to targeted resistance training, and finish with a cooling down phase that includes stretching or yoga. This balanced approach ensures that every facet of fitness is addressed, fostering a steady fitness schedule that keeps you engaged and motivated.

Integrating Recovery and Mindfulness
A common misconception is that more exercise always equates to better results. However, recovery is an integral component of any effective fitness regimen. Allocating time for rest and active recovery sessions is essential for muscle repair and mental rejuvenation. Incorporate activities like gentle stretching, yoga, or even meditation into your reliable exercise routine. These recovery practices not only help prevent injury but also sustain the continuous performance boost you experience from consistent training.
